Consider Final Fantasy VI(or FFIII NA, basically the Terra/Tina one) if you can get it. There are still fans of it out there, and I think it's a pretty good FF, at least. Note that there is a GBA port, and it was originally for SNES, also available on virtual console and PSN. Pricing of anthology which includes FFV ~17 on ebay and amazon

Looking through metacritic, because I am more of SNES-PS2 person rather than SNES-PSX-PS2 person, Star Ocean: The Second Story seems to score moderately well(80, and lowest Gamefaqs review score 4) though I suggest you watch some youtube gameplay vids about the game/series first. It has an enhanced remake Star Ocean: Second Evolution on the PSP, which is a reason you might not want to get it. Pricing ranges are extreme for Second Story, 116 on amazon, while for Second Evolution is 30(down to 22) on amazon. Ebay prices span quite a range.

I also agree with The Legend of Dragoon, I recently started playing that one again myself. As for other RPG's, I would definitely recommend Breath of Fire III and IV, and SaGa Frontier. Those were some of my favorites. Symphony of the Night is an amazing game as well. Although it's certainly not a traditional RPG, there is a lot of character progression in it.

Lunar had 4 discs, but only 2 of them were game discs; it also came with a 'making of' cd, and a soundtrack, as well as a small artbook... and a map... :)
